🔎 Directory Scan Defense

IP 52.172.225.211 is enumerating directories. Configure fail2ban apache-404 jail after 10+ 404 errors. Disable directory listings. Normalize all 404 responses.

🌊 Flood / DDoS Mitigation

Implement limit_req_zone in nginx. Deploy CDN with DDoS protection. Configure SYN cookies and connection tracking to throttle 52.172.225.211.

🤖 Bot Detection

Address UA spoofing from 52.172.225.211: maintain blocklist of known malicious UA strings, require consistent UA across sessions, implement TLS fingerprinting.

💡 DDoS Mitigation Approaches

Distributed denial of service attacks overwhelm infrastructure with traffic volume. Effective mitigation combines always-on traffic scrubbing, anycast network distribution, rate limiting, and the ability to quickly scale absorption capacity during attacks.

💡 Email Authentication: SPF, DKIM, DMARC

Email authentication protocols work together to prevent spoofing. SPF validates sending servers, DKIM provides cryptographic message signing, and DMARC defines enforcement policies. Full implementation significantly reduces phishing effectiveness.
